3. alarm Hour digits flash Press or to change hour Press NEXT Minute digits flash Press or to change minutes Press NEXT If in 12 hour format AM PM flashes Press or to change Press NEXT Press or to select DAILY WEEKDAYS OR WEEKENDS Press DONE to confirm and exit Press Start Split or Stop Reset to arm or disarm alarm When disarmed OFF will be displayed When armed the alarm clock icon will appear The INDIGLO night light and alarm icon flashes and an alert sounds when the alarm goes off Press any button to silence A back up alarm will sound after five mintues if you don t press any buttons ONAARWHL S Press MODE repeatedly until TIMER appears Press SET Hour digits flash Follow same pattern as setting TIME and ALARM to set hours up to 24 hrs minutes sec onds and select between REPEAT AT END timer counts down and then repeats or STOP AT END the timer counts down and then stops Press DONE to confirm and exit Press START SPLIT to start TIMER Timer will continue to run even if you exit Timer mode If REPEAT END selected will flash If STOP END selected f will flash An alarm melody will chime and INDIGLO night light flashes when the timer has reached zero or before it starts to count down again 7 Press STOP RESET to stop TIMER Press again to reset to countdown time wn os gt continued on reverse LAP 1 LAP 2 LAP 3 LAP 4 7 11 MIN 7
4. ay be located at the 3 o clock position Press MODE until DEMO appears This mode will allow you to view all the features of the watch Each mode will appear for three seconds Setting date will erase this feature It will reappear when you change the battery TIME DATE HOURLY CHIME TIME ZONE 1 In TIME mode press and hold SET Time zone will flash 2 To set push or to select first or second time zone 3 Press NEXT Hour digits flash 4 Press or to change hour including AM PM Scroll through 12 hours to get to AM PM 5 Press NEXT Minute digits flash 6 Press or to change minutes 7 Press NEXT Second digits flash 8 Press or to set seconds to Zero 9 Press NEXT Day of week flashes 0 Press to to change day 1 Continue pattern to set month day of month 12 hour or 24 hour time display MM DD or DD MM date format turn hourly CHIME on off turn BEEP on off If you select BEEP on a beep will sound every time you push a button except INDIGLO 12 Press DONE to confirm and exit or NEXT to continue and set second time zone if desired 13 When in Time mode press and hold START SPLIT to peek at second time zone hold for 4 seconds to switch time zones Setting the ALARM is similar to setting TIME Your watch model has three alarms Follow below procedure to set each alarm Press MODE repeatedly until ALM1 ALM2 or ALM3 appears Select alarm you want to set Press SET to set

6. hours or until deacti vated by pressing and holding INDIGLO again for 4 seconds WATER amp SHOCK RESISTANCE If your watch is water resistant meter marking or exw is indicated NOoOBWDN Water Resistance Depth p s i a Water Pressure Below Surface 30m 98ft 60 50m 164ft 86 100m 328ft 160 pounds per square inch absolute WARNING TO MAINTAIN WATER RESISTANCE DO NOT PRESS ANY BUTTONS UNDER WATER 1 Watch is water resistant only as long as lens push buttons and case remain intact 2 Watch is not a diver watch and should not be used for diving 3 Rinse watch with fresh water after exposure to salt water 4 Shock resistance will be indicated on watch face or caseback Watches are designed to pass ISO test for shock resistance However care should be taken to avoid damaging crystal lens BATTERY Timex strongly recommends that a retailer or jeweler replace battery If applicable push reset button when replacing battery Battery type is indicated on caseback Battery life esti mates are based on certain assumptions regarding usage battery life may vary depending on actual usage DO NOT DISPOSE OF BATTERY IN FIRE DO NOT RECHARGE KEEP LOOSE BATTERIES AWAY FROM CHILDREN TIMEX INTERNATIONAL WARRANTY U S LIMITED WARRANTY PLEASE SEE FRONT OF INSTRUCTION BOOKLET FOR TERMS OF EXTENDED WARRANTY OFFER Your TIMEX watch is warranted against manufacturing defects by Timex Corporation for a
